Kickstart Your Online Business Journey: A Guide to Registration
Launching a successful online business requires careful planning and execution. One of the initial steps that often trips up aspiring entrepreneurs is understanding and navigating the online business registration process. This guide aims to simplify this crucial aspect, providing you with a clear roadmap to ensure a smooth and efficient start.
First, determine the legal structure for your business. Common options include sole proprietorships, partnerships, LLCs, and corporations, each with its own advantages. Researching these structures thoroughly will help you choose the one that best suits your needs and goals. Next, gather all the necessary materials. This typically includes your business name, contact information, registered agent details, and a statement of purpose.
Once you have compiled the required documentation, proceed with the online registration process. Most jurisdictions offer user-friendly platforms where you can submit your application electronically.
Be sure to review all requirements carefully and ensure accuracy before submitting your application.
After successful submission, be prepared for a processing period during which your application will be reviewed. You will typically receive confirmation once your registration is complete.
